What is a security system engineer?

Security System Engineers are professionals who design, implement, and maintain security systems to protect buildings, assets, and information from unauthorized access or harm. They work with technologies such as surveillance cameras, alarm systems, access control, and cybersecurity measures. Their responsibilities include assessing security risks, selecting appropriate technologies, configuring system components,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ring that all security systems comply with relevant laws and standards. Security System Engineers often collaborate with IT teams, facility managers, and law enforcement to provide comprehensive protection solutions.

What are some common challenges security system engineers face when integrating new technologies into existing infrastructures?

Security System Engineers often encounter challenges such as ensuring compatibility between new and legacy hardware, maintaining system uptime during upgrades, and addressing potential security vulnerabilities introduced by new components. Additionally, they must coordinate with IT, facilities, and management teams to minimize disruptions and adhere to compliance standards. Proactive planning, thorough testing, and clear communication are essential to successfully integrating advanced security solutions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a security system eng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Security System Engineer, you need a strong background in network security, systems architecture, and information technology,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with security tools such as firewalls, intrusion detection/prevention systems (IDS/IPS), and certifications like CISSP or CompTIA Security+ are typically required. Anal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ication are essential so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ure robust protection of organizational assets, effective risk mitigation, and clear collaboration with both technical and non-technical stakeholders.

What is the difference between Security System Engineer vs Security Analyst?

AspectSecurity System EngineerSecurity Analyst
CertificationsSecurity+, CISSP, CEHSecurity+, CISSP, GIAC
Work EnvironmentDesigns and implements security systems, often in technical or engineering teamsMonitors, analyzes, and responds to security incidents, often in security operations centers
Employer & Industry UsageTech companies, security firms, large enterprisesFinancial institutions, government agencies, corporate security teams

Security System Engineers focus on designing and deploying security infrastructure, while Security Analysts monitor and respond to security threats. Both roles require similar certifications and often work within the same industry sectors, but their daily tasks and responsibilities differ significantly.
